Apley's Concise System of Orthopaedics and Fractures is firmly established as the leading introductory textbook of orthopaedics, ideal for medical students, trainee surgeons and any health professional looking for an accessible overview of this important speciality. Praised in previous editions for the systematic approach, balanced content and easy-to-read style, all of which have been retained and improved, this new edition has been brought completely up to date.

Key features:

* Thoroughly revised - reflecting the changing pattern of musculoskeletal disease around the world for an international readership
* Integration of basic science with clinical chapters - puts the fundamentals underpinning the subject in a clinical context, in line with current teaching practice
* New anatomical detail in regional orthopaedics - including high-quality anatomical line diagrams to enhance understanding
* Unrivalled level of illustration - over 1300 illustrations, many new to this edition, provide a clear, pictorial account of the subject
* Provides helpful guidance on simple procedures without unnecessary operative detail - ideal for the student and early trainee
* Reader-friendly design - including 'stop check' boxes, bullet lists and summaries, ideal for rapid reference in the clinical and during exam preparation

The book remains the first choice for those seeking a brief account of this large and complex subject.

"This text has moved a long way since Apley's original 1959 publication, and has been expanded to become a general orthopaedic text for medical students and other students of orthopaedics. The original (remembered fondly from my own student days) with its 'Look, Feel, Move' mantra focused on teaching students a systematic hands-on approach to orthopaedic evaluation, not relying heavily on special investigations.

The current edition incorporates the original Apley system, but it has been expanded to become a more general reference, richly illustrated with colour photographs, X-ray and other clinical images, and illustrations. ... All in all it is a wonderful little textbook, and a pleasure to recommend to students." Sheila Strover, BSc, MB BCh, MBA, book review appearing on www.kneeguru.co.uk, February 09, 2015
